Description

The building is a mill located immediately northwest of Longstock Mill House. It dates from the mid-18th century and was altered in 1893. The structure is made of brick, featuring decorative blue brick elements. It is a two-storey and attic, five-bay mill with mill streams under both end bays. The right side of the building contains a 1893 roller mill that originally had four storeys but now has two.

The older mill has a two-storey central opening with one planked door above another. The other bays feature 20th-century two-light windows in their original openings, all of which have segmented heads with a course of blue headers, except for the bottom left opening, which is filled with blue headers. The mill has dentilled eaves and a large weatherboarded gable above the central three bays, which was originally for a hoist but now has a window. There are sloping buttresses on the left end and 20th-century tie plates along the attic floor level.

On the right side, there is a two-storey, three-bay 19th-century building with a garage door to the left and large segmental-headed iron windows. Inside the old mill, the breast shot wheel has been removed, but much of the rest of the structure remains intact. Behind the 19th-century mill, there is an Armfield turbine.
